Hi, unfortunately, your compression ratio will be way too high with that combination.  The reason is because the the swirl chambers on the 1.6 head aren't big enough to handle a 1.9's worth of displacement squished into them.  Even using a thicker head gasket to compensate (which generally isn't considered a good idea on an IDI engine) won't be able to bring it in line.

1.9 head on a 1.6 works great, but a 1.6 head on a 1.9 is just pointless, i bet the engine would lose power.
the 1.9 head flows way better than a 1.6 head. and lowers the compression so we can build more boost.

The 1.9 head has bigger valves then the 1.6.

Putting a thicker head gasket in won't significantly reduce the compression ratio, but it will certainly screw up squish, quench, and the turbulence in the swirl chambers.

yea, not a chance in hell it will do as good w/ a 1.6 head. the valves are bigger, the ports are bigger, and i think the cam may even have more lift than a 1.6 cam. sure it will work, but why would you want to make it harder for your engine to breathe? that just sounds stupid. and you will probably have like 30:1 compression. thicker/more head gaskets work on gas engines, but they arent as critical on the squish, quench and turbulence in the combustion chamber.

1.9 head on 1.6 will do as much as the rest of the mods will support. The head allows better breathing, so you can do more with fuel, intake, boost, exhaust, etc. than what you could have before. This is all to a point, I don't think anyone has made over 300HP with one of the 1.6s. I know I have heard of some that were in the 250 range.
